Ministry of Land, Infrastructure and Transport Announces Legislative Notice for Amendment to Subordinate Legislation of the Urban Railroad Act
Enforcement Decree of the Urban Railroad Act, Enforcement Rules of the Urban Railroad Act, Regulations on Construction and Operation of Tramways, etc.
[Asia Economy Reporter Cha Wanyong] On the 6th, the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ure and Transport announced that starting from the 7th, it will publicly notify the amendment bills to the Enforcement Decree of the Urban Railroad Act, the Enforcement Rules of the Urban Railroad Act, and the Rules on the Construction and Operation of Trams, to establish a logistics system linking freight trucks and freight subways using the urban railroad network.
First, the Ministry of Land will improve related regulations to clearly include logistics facilities installed at urban railroad vehicle depots by urban railroad operators for logistics ancillary businesses as ‘urban railroad facilities.’ Accordingly, urban railroad operators will be able to install logistics facilities such as parcel sorting centers and warehouses within urban railroad facilities without changing the urban management plan.
Additionally, through the amendment of the Enforcement Rules of the Urban Railroad Act, the Ministry will clarify the criteria for aggravated penalties for repeated violations by urban railroad operators by changing the application timing of aggravated penalties from the ‘date of the first administrative disposition’ to the ‘date the first violation was detected.’
Through the Rules on the Construction and Operation of Trams, improvements will be made to allow exceptional left-side driving in special cases such as driving within vehicle depots restricted to the public, test driving, and temporary single-track operation due to accidents.
Currently, trams operating on double-track rails are generally required to drive on the right side; however, in cases where the track or tram is broken down, vehicles operating for recovery from accidents, or vehicles operating for construction, left-side driving is permitted after safety measures are secured.
